When our kids were little, hubby and I would feel When our kids were little, hubby and I would feel guilty and sad around this time of year because they weren’t getting the experience of a boisterous house full of family - cousins, uncles, aunts, grandparents…they just got us. And for a few years it tormented us, though we always put on a happy face and worked hard to make it as special, and as memorable as possible. We have strived to give them all the love and joy we can. 

And though they have delighted in the rare occasions where we share these moments with others, they have expressed, as recently as this weekend, how much more meaningful and special it is for them when it is just us. The first time they expressed these sentiments to us, years ago when they were much younger, Travis and I realized that while we wasted years being worried and stressed and guilted over not being able to give our kids that picture perfect family-filled holiday experience, we failed to appreciate how what we were giving them…just us two…was and is enough, and something they not only look forward to but are hesitant to share with others.

And they never let us forget it, lest we feel tempted to change things up. Our gatherings may be small, and it may just be us, but for our kids, it is enough and as they have expressed, “absolute perfection”.

May this give solace to those whom have chosen a happier, healthier path for their own family even if it feels smaller than most.
